TL;DR: Structural and functional analyses show that the fusion peptide-specific mAbs bind with different modalities to a cryptic epitope, which is hidden in prefusion stabilized S, and becomes exposed upon binding of angiotensin-converting enzyme 2 (ACE2) or ACE2-mimicking mAbs.

TL;DR: It is demonstrated that the ratchet helix modulates helicase activity and suggested that the arch domain plays a previously unrecognized role in unwinding substrates.

TL;DR: This work characterized the N-methyltransferase activity of the MT domain as both the isolated domain (MTBSLS) and as part of the full NRPS megaenzyme, suggesting that embedding MT into the A2 domain of BSLS is not required for the product assembly, but is critical for the overall yields of the final products.
